> > > > I would like to fix a bug in brltty for some devices: the esys and
> > > > iris braille devices whose size is bigger than 40 cells. See the
> > > > attached patch: the eubrl_usbWrite() part of it fixes displaying on them
> > > > (otherwise it remains completely blank). The esysiris_SysIdentity() part
> > > > of it fixes a buffer overflow when they are connected (same USB ID, but
> > > > bigger model number).
